The Moore-McLean Insurance Group Pedals for Juvenile Diabetes

Once again, the Moore-McLean Insurance Group joined the fun and excitement downtown for the Juvenile Diabetes Research Fund's 'Ride For Diabetes Research' event. This unique annual fundraiser encourages Corporate Canada to engage in a friendly competition to see who can log the most kilometers on a stationary bike while raising money for the cause.

Groups are divided into teams of 5 riders who take turns riding a stationary bike for eight minutes each over the course of 40 minutes. The day is broken down into 1-hour intervals to allow for various teams to compete with little interruption to the busy workday schedule.

The Moore-McLean Insurance Group participates year after year because the Ride for Diabetes Research is highly motivating, a great team building event and a tonne of fun.
